Aspiration Europe are a Supporting Partner for the much-anticipated art sculpture trail, GoGoDragons, which will inhabit the streets of Norwich in Summer 2015. The GoGoDragons event celebrates art, brings additional visitors to Norwich and is a major fundraising event for Break Charity: raising vital funds to support their work with local families and vulnerable young people.
Anne Ovens, founder and director of Aspiration Europe, a Cambridge company providing business finance outsourcing & consulting services, was appointed a trustee for Break during the summer.
Break delivers a valuable range of support services for young people and families in East Anglia and provides six mainstream children’s homes to provide residential care for Looked After Children in a small ‘family’ home environment.
Anne is a committed supporter of Break’s work with vulnerable children and those in the care system and has welcomed these opportunities to extend her on-going support for the charity.
